Serves meat, vegan options available. A brewery/restaurant that serves Mexican food with several, well-labeled vegan options, including all the beer. Open Mon-Sat 12:00am-8:00pm, Sun 12:00pm-8:00pm.

Love that the menu has vegan options marked, kind of sad that they use the vegan V to mean vegetarian though—you’ll do a double take! The falafel sandwich is really good; great focaccia by any standard, and the toum is legit. The house made pickles are pretty mediocre sadly. Oh and very solid fries too.
Read moreNote that not all the beers are vegan; several are brewed with honey. It’s called out on the menu but if in doubt, ask.

The Brewhaus has so many vegan options! Most menu items can be made vegan by substituting for local macnut cheese. The servers are very knowledgeable and friendly about what options are vegan. I recommend the kabocha pumpkin with vegan Creme fraiche or the Astro Nachos with falafel and macnut cheese. Their beer is good, too!
